    IPC分类号: G06F3/038 H03K19/0175

    摘要: There are provided: a first logic operation circuit which performs a logic operation using a high-amplitude logic signal; a transmission system having a load capacitance; and a low-voltage signal generator which is a step-down level shifter transforming an incoming high-amplitude logic signal from the first logic operation circuit to a low-amplitude logic signal having a lower amplitude than the high-amplitude logic signal for output to the transmission system. In the configuration, the first logic operation circuit operates based on a high-amplitude logic signal, and is therefore free from malfunctions and performs operations at high speed. Further, the transmission system introducing a load capacitance transmits a low-amplitude logic signal and therefore restrains increases in electric power consumption and occurrence of unnecessary radiation.

    Liquid crystal light valve with dual function as both optical-to-electrical and optical-to-optical transducer 失效
    液晶光阀,具有双重功能,既可以是光电对光转换器

    公开(公告)号:US5467204A

    公开(公告)日:1995-11-14

    申请号:US988040

    申请日:1992-12-09

    摘要: A liquid crystal light valve and a various information processors is provided. The processors have the liquid crystal light valve in which information formed in a liquid crystal layer and corresponding to address light can be read as an optical signal and can be directly read as an electric signal.A liquid crystal light valve has a glass substrate, an antireflection film, a transparent electrode, an opposite electrode, an optical waveguide, a photoconductive layer, a light interrupting layer, an orientational film, a spacer and a liquid crystal layer. The optical waveguide is composed of a lower clad layer, a core layer and a clad layer. A light source and a photodetector are connected to both ends of the optical waveguide. For example, the light source is constructed by a laser, a light emitting diode (LED), etc. The light source is connected to the optical waveguide such that a polarized wave can be guided to the optical waveguide. For example, the photodetector is constructed by an a-Si:H diode, an a-SiGe:H diode, etc. in accordance with a wavelength of the light source. The photodetector is connected to the optical waveguide so as to receive light therefrom.

    Liquid crystal light valve with dielectric mirror containing semiconductor oxide, ferroelectric material or conductive material 失效
    具有介电镜的液晶光阀,含有半导体氧化物,铁电材料或导电材料

    公开(公告)号:US5760853A

    公开(公告)日:1998-06-02

    申请号:US516397

    申请日:1995-08-17

    IPC分类号: G02F1/1335 G02F1/135

    CPC分类号: G02F1/133553 G02F1/135

    摘要: A liquid crystal light valve includes a transparent substrate having a transparent electrode, a photoconducting layer and a dielectric mirror layer including a plurality of dielectric films formed in this order on a surface thereof, a transparent substrate having a transparent electrode formed on a surface thereof, and a liquid crystal layer held between the transparent substrates. The dielectric mirror layer includes a high packing density portion as the outermost layer on the liquid crystal layer side, and a low packing density portion with a packing density lower than that of the high packing density portion. This structure improves the optical characteristic and the manufacturing efficiency of the liquid crystal light valve.

    Active matrix substrate 有权
    有源矩阵基板

    公开(公告)号:US07167151B2

    公开(公告)日:2007-01-23

    申请号:US10360931

    申请日:2003-02-10

    IPC分类号: G01R31/00

    摘要: Each of a plurality of source lines is connected to a video signal line via an analog switch and a read-out switch, which are turned ON/OFF by a source line driving circuit. When the analog switch of the source line is turned ON and the read-out switch thereof is turned OFF, the selected source line is connected to the video signal line, thereby writing a video signal to a storage capacitor of a picture element via a picture element transistor. When the analog switch of the source line is turned OFF and the read-out switch thereof is turned ON, a signal stored in a storage capacitor is read out from the source line to the read-out line via the picture element transistor. The read-out line is a single line shared by the plurality of source lines.
